Landscape Foreman

Status: Full time
Hourly rate: $18-$22/hour DOE

SUMMARY:
Performs routine and specialized tasks involved in either landscape maintenance or construction under supervision of the Landscape Manager and Assistant Managers. Trains and leads seasonal landscape crews in job duties and performs most tasks within the department.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

The safe and skilled operation of most powered equipment such as: Maintenance Vehicles, Sprayers, Small Tractors, Blowers, Rotary Mowers, String Trimmers, Edgers, Chainsaw, Sod Cutter, Compact utility loader, etc. Installation and maintenance of plant material. Participates in irrigation repair & maintenance. Trains, leads, and holds accountable seasonal landscape crew members to maintenance standards. Makes and reports daily observations of site conditions. Ensures that at the end of the day the equipment and hand tools are thoroughly cleaned and then stored in its proper location. Perform daily repairs and preventive maintenance on equipment and hand tools. Required to wear supplied safety equipment: Safety Glasses, Earplugs, Back Support, etc. Reports equipment problems or failures to the Assistant Manager immediately. Able to effectively handle multiple tasks. Incorporates safe work practices in job performance. Regular and reliable attendance. Maintains a professional standard at Juniper Preserve including, but not limited to, appearance, interaction with members, associates, guests of the club, verbal discussions and written correspondence. Does not discuss work related issues with members and resort guests. Maintains a positive attitude and the flexibility to take on new and different tasks as assigned by the Landscape Manager.
  

QUALIFICATIONS:
To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

Two- or four-year certificates or degrees, or equivalent work experience in landscape field. Must be able to read and understand written and oral instructions. Must be able to comprehend topics of a conceptual nature. Ability to add, subtract, multiply, and divide in all units of measure, using whole numbers, common fractions, and decimals. Ability to compute rate, ratio, and percentages. Ability to define problems, collect data, establish facts, and draw valid conclusions. Ability to interpret a variety of job-related instruction manuals.


S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ES:
Trains and leads seasonal landscape crews in job duties.

CERTIFICATES,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S:

Oregon pesticide applicators license. Irrigation certification.
